I really like ants… have some facts!
there are currently 15,000 ants species, though there is probably much more yet to be discovered!!
honeypot ants use their abdomens to store honeydew, and can be eaten! (image 1)
leafcutter ants pile leaves in order to grow fungus to eat! (image 2)
ants place their brood in different places based on which stage of metamorphosis they are in, and even place the brood depending on what level of moisture they need!!
some ant species use the silk from the larvae to stick leaves together to make a nest (image 3)
